Germany’s Largest Floating Solar Plant to Come Up in Open-Pit Lignite Mine Site

The government officials in eastern German Cottbus have paved way for the development of the largest floating solar power plant in Germany. The solar plant will come up on the Cottbus Ostsee lake which is a man-made lake created out of a former open-pit lignite mine. The announcement of the upcoming solar power project has […]

Waaree Energies Supplies Solar Panels for Terapanth Foods’ Solar Project at Bhavnagar, Gujarat

One of India’s top firms for supplying iodized salt to major FMCG brands, Terapanth Foods Limited- a Friends Group Company, has commissioned a 4 MW solar power project at Bhavnagar, Gujarat. Leading solar manufacturer Waaree Energies provided the firm with 335Wp polycrystalline solar panels for the said project. Pankaj Babulal Singhvi from Terapanth Foods, stated, […]

Germany’s Svevind to Develop 20 GW Green Hydrogen Project in Kazakhstan

Just as the European Union toils for renewable energy expansion and possible import of clean energy, German renewable energy player Svevind Energy Group looks to invest a massive $50 billion for the development of a 20 GW green hydrogen project in Kazakhstan, for which an agreement has been signed between Svevind and the Kazakh Government. German Grid Operator Awards Ostwind 3 Offshore Substation Contract to Multi Party JV

50Hertz – the German offshore transmission system operator (TSO) – has asked a joint venture comprising HSM Offshore Energy, Smulders, and Iv-Offshore & Energy for the development of an offshore high voltage substation called ‘Ostwind 3’ that would lie in the Baltic Sea.
